What if you could make one decision, and that decision would automate nearly every decision you'll ever make again? Today we're going to talk about exactly that. Many years ago, I unconsciously made a decision. I established a set of core values and guiding principles, and in doing so, it became the ultimate decision-making engine that predetermined every other decision for myself. It enabled me to know who I would be and how I would respond to any challenge or opportunity. In today's episode, I'm giving you a simple process that will make your life easier, improve your self-discipline, and essentially make most of your future decisions for you.
